Franciane Pellizzari is a scholar working on Oceanography, Ecology and Molecular Biology. According to data from OpenAlex, Franciane Pellizzari has authored 35 papers receiving a total of 736 indexed citations (citations by other indexed papers that have themselves been cited), including 21 papers in Oceanography, 19 papers in Ecology and 4 papers in Molecular Biology. Recurrent topics in Franciane Pellizzari's work include Marine and coastal plant biology (18 papers), Marine Biology and Ecology Research (15 papers) and Polar Research and Ecology (9 papers). Franciane Pellizzari is often cited by papers focused on Marine and coastal plant biology (18 papers), Marine Biology and Ecology Research (15 papers) and Polar Research and Ecology (9 papers). Franciane Pellizzari collaborates with scholars based in Brazil, United Kingdom and United States. Franciane Pellizzari's co-authors include Eurico C. Oliveirã, Luiz Henrique Rosa, Carlos A. Rosa, Nair S. Yokoya, Adriana O. Medeiros, Maria Eugênia R. Duarte, Miguel D. Noseda, Elsa B. Damonte, Mariana C. Oliveira and Theresinha Monteiro Absher and has published in prestigious journals such as The ISME Journal, Marine Pollution Bulletin and Marine Ecology Progress Series.
